Output d3aa1e91fb91ec39bbf0bfa0d5ee84d5696d2546d9bb1774b98d60314faa5f9a:0

value
585905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78762e032ea588ca8acccc7faf06af1a53de1f84 OP_EQUAL
address
3CfxaqQbrxkm3xRPweXHJtFXMjEp551CRi
transaction
d3aa1e91fb91ec39bbf0bfa0d5ee84d5696d2546d9bb1774b98d60314faa5f9a
spent
true